#ee4750 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ee4750 is composed of 93.3% red, 27.8%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.2% magenta, 66.4%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 356.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 60.6%. #ee4750 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8ea0 with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#ee4750 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ee4750 has RGB values of R:238, G:71,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.66,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15615824.

Shades and Tints of #ee4750
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0102 is the darkest color, while #fffb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ee4750
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19495 is the less saturated color, while #fd3842 is the most saturated one.
